Noise-Canceling Headphones for Working From Home: What Actually Matters
The Feature Remote Workers Actually Need
Every headphone review focuses on music quality. But if you're buying headphones for remote work, the priority list is completely different. Call microphone quality, all-day comfort, and ANC effectiveness matter more than bass response or soundstage. A headphone that sounds amazing for music but has a terrible mic is useless for your daily standups.
What Matters (In Order)
1. Microphone Quality for Calls
This is the #1 feature for remote work headphones and the one most reviews ignore. Your colleagues don't care about your headphone's frequency response, they care about hearing you clearly on a Zoom call. Look for headphones with dedicated call microphones (not just the ANC mics repurposed for calls) and wind noise reduction.
2. All-Day Comfort
You'll wear these 4-8 hours. Clamping force, ear pad material, weight, and heat buildup matter enormously over a full workday. Memory foam pads are more comfortable than leather for long sessions. Lighter headphones (under 260g) cause less neck fatigue. If your ears touch the drivers inside the cups, the cups are too small, look for deeper ear pads.
3. ANC Effectiveness
Active Noise Cancellation blocks constant low-frequency sounds: HVAC hum, airplane engines, traffic rumble, washing machine vibrations. It's less effective against voices, dogs barking, and sudden sharp sounds. If your main distraction is background hum, ANC is transformative. If it's your roommate talking, ANC helps but won't fully solve the problem.
4. Multi-Device Connectivity
Remote workers switch between laptop (calls), phone (messages), and sometimes a tablet. Headphones that connect to two devices simultaneously (multipoint Bluetooth) save you from the constant disconnect-reconnect dance. Most premium headphones now support this, make sure yours does.
Price Tier Breakdown
| Tier | What You Get | Best For |
|---|---|---|
| Budget ($50-80) | Decent ANC, basic mic, OK comfort | Occasional use, backup pair |
| Mid-Range ($100-200) | Good ANC, decent mic, all-day comfort | Daily remote workers |
| Premium ($250-400) | Excellent ANC, great mic, multipoint, premium materials | All-day callers, frequent travelers |
Over-Ear vs. In-Ear for Work
Over-ear headphones are more comfortable for long sessions and generally have better ANC. But they're hot in summer, mess up your hair (if that matters for camera), and feel isolating. ANC earbuds are lighter, less obtrusive on camera, and won't make you sweat, but they can cause ear fatigue after 3-4 hours and their mics tend to be worse in noisy environments.
The Hybrid Strategy
Some remote workers keep two options: over-ear ANC headphones for deep focus work (writing, coding, design) and ANC earbuds for calls and meetings. The earbuds are less noticeable on camera, and the headphones are more comfortable for long silent stretches. Switch based on the task.
